diff options
author | mark <mark@138bc75d-0d04-0410-961f-82ee72b054a4> | 2003-02-13 23:28:57 +0000 |
---|---|---|
committer | mark <mark@138bc75d-0d04-0410-961f-82ee72b054a4> | 2003-02-13 23:28:57 +0000 |
commit | 594aa8e1fdc0092bd75dbb30b7eee77d38fcac56 (patch) | |
tree | b7941689463b942e582cf141fc6b91939a2fadcc /libjava/java/io | |
parent | 846f36b8dcab199a4c2da5de68d5bc383afdb5fe (diff) | |
download | ppe42-gcc-594aa8e1fdc0092bd75dbb30b7eee77d38fcac56.tar.gz ppe42-gcc-594aa8e1fdc0092bd75dbb30b7eee77d38fcac56.zip |
* java/io/InputStreamReader.java (getEncoding): Return null when
closed.
* java/io/OutputStreamWriter.java (getEncoding): Likewise.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@62875 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'libjava/java/io')
-rw-r--r-- | libjava/java/io/InputStreamReader.java | 7 | ||||
-rw-r--r-- | libjava/java/io/OutputStreamWriter.java | 7 |
2 files changed, 10 insertions, 4 deletions
diff --git a/libjava/java/io/InputStreamReader.java b/libjava/java/io/InputStreamReader.java index fff979c97ac..80272d01a22 100644 --- a/libjava/java/io/InputStreamReader.java +++ b/libjava/java/io/InputStreamReader.java @@ -1,4 +1,4 @@ -/* Copyright (C) 1998, 1999, 2001 Free Software Foundation +/* Copyright (C) 1998, 1999, 2001, 2003 Free Software Foundation This file is part of libgcj. @@ -70,7 +70,10 @@ public class InputStreamReader extends Reader } } - public String getEncoding() { return converter.getName(); } + public String getEncoding() + { + return in != null ? converter.getName() : null; + } public boolean ready() throws IOException { diff --git a/libjava/java/io/OutputStreamWriter.java b/libjava/java/io/OutputStreamWriter.java index 527ff75c66b..d49e104773a 100644 --- a/libjava/java/io/OutputStreamWriter.java +++ b/libjava/java/io/OutputStreamWriter.java @@ -1,4 +1,4 @@ -/* Copyright (C) 1998, 1999, 2000, 2001 Free Software Foundation +/* Copyright (C) 1998, 1999, 2000, 2001, 2003 Free Software Foundation This file is part of libgcj. @@ -28,7 +28,10 @@ public class OutputStreamWriter extends Writer private char[] work; private int wcount; - public String getEncoding() { return converter.getName(); } + public String getEncoding() + { + return out != null ? converter.getName() : null; + } private OutputStreamWriter(OutputStream out, UnicodeToBytes encoder) { |